// Fixture: Nightwick backfill scheduler, nightly window 01:00–04:00.
// Simulates three tenants with staggered backfill jobs against the
// Corvella warehouse. The scheduler should skip any tenant whose
// previous run is still open — the fixture seeds one stuck run to
// verify that path. If you're on call and a backfill hangs, check
// the lease table first; the scheduler won't self-heal until the
// lease expires. The test harness talks to the staging API and
// authenticates with the bearer token below.

session JWT of yawep-yawep = eyJhbGciOiJIUzI1NiIsInR5cCI6IkpXVCJ9.eyJzdWIiOiI3pWF3_In0.aXYsHiog

**Ticket: Staging env misconfigured for monthly partitioning**

The Ledgerline staging database is creating partitions by week instead of month because `PARTITION_GRANULARITY` was copied from the analytics sandbox. This breaks the retention job and doubles storage. For the weekly sync: fix is to set `PARTITION_GRANULARITY=month` in staging's env file, then immediately below that line add the rotation credential:

sealed setting: ARCHIVE_KEY3=8d0

For branch managers.

We are evaluating a transfer of tier-one customer support to Quillon Services, with a pilot covering the Dunmere and Ashvale regions beginning next quarter. Expected savings: roughly 18% of support operating cost. Branch-level impacts: local support desks would handle escalations only, and two roles per branch would be redeployed rather than cut. Quillon's service levels will be reviewed monthly during the pilot. Your feedback is due before the leadership session. The decision hinges on one strategic consideration:

board note of bajop-yaweg: The western region missed its Pelys quota by 58.0 percent last quarter. Pelysek Foods plans to raise the Belius list price by 44.0 percent in July. The steering committee signed off on a budget of $133.8 million for Project Pelax. The renewal with Zoraelix Systems closes at $61.9 million a year, 12.7 percent above the last contract.